TransNamib/ HyRail Namibia: Introducing Green Hydrogen as a Locomotive Fuel

Rail-Bus 5 months ago

A consortium led by Hyphen Technical, comprised of TransNamib (the Namibian National Railways), the University of Namibia, CMB.TECH and Traxtion, were successfully awarded funding towards the consortium’s proposed €7.6 million (over $7.37m) hydrogen locomotive project.

Australian Government Orders Independent Review of Inland Rail

Rail-Bus 5 months ago

The Australian Government announced the appointment of Dr Kerry Schott AO to lead an independent review to assess the governance and program delivery approaches of the Inland Rail Program. Portugal: National Train Operator to Acquire 12 High Speed Trains in 2023

Rail-Bus 5 months ago

Lisbon,Oct.10,2022(Lusa)–CP, Portugal’s incumbent rail operator, wants to launch, in 2023, a tender for the acquisition of 12 high-speed trains worth 336 million euros, according to the report accompanying the draft state budget for 2023.
